Skip to main content

We wrote stories and linked it to figma components(via copy link to selection cmd+L) within the stories. 

We then did branching and started rolling out incremental updates, but now on merging a branch, the pasted Figma links are taking the users to a cover page and not the component.

Is this normal? How do you work when the components are getting incremental updates? 

Hey ​@Dhruv_Srivastava — welcome to Figma Forum, and thanks for raising this! I checked with our Technical Quality team and wanted to share some context on what may be happening.

It sounds like the links you created point to frames within the branch file, which means the URLs include the node ID and branch ID. When the branch is merged and archived, those URLs still reference the archived branch rather than the main file node. Does that match what you’re seeing?

Let me know if this helps. If this doesn’t clarify things or if other questions remain, please reply here and I’ll be happy to help troubleshoot further. 🙏🏻


Hey ​@Tom Reem, thanks for the kind welcome, and checking in with the Technical Quality team
So we’ve actively copied links from the main file and not the branch. 

Here’s some additional detail listed with the two separate scenarios we encountered, we have a frame with a modal component...

  1. Contents of the modal got replaced in the merge, link copied was for the whole modal(frame). (Link broke on merge)
  2. Entire modal(contents + frame) got replaced in the merge, link copied was for the whole modal(frame). (Link broke on merge)

Lemme know if you need more info on this. 
Thanks again Tom!

🤗


Hi ​@Dhruv_Srivastava — thanks so much for laying out these scenarios, and apologies for the wait. The extra detail is really helpful for narrowing this down and I’ve raised this internally as well.

If you’re open to it, I’d love to loop in our Technical Quality team directly so they can take a closer look at the specific file where you’re running into this. Catching the behavior directly in context will help with next steps. To kick things off, could you please fill out this form and include:

  • a link to the file where this is happening
  • ‘can edit’ access granted to support-share@figma.com for the impacted file (this will not impact billing)
  • a screen recording showing the issue in action (if possible).

Please keep me posted on how it’s going — I’m always happy to dig deeper. 💯